
Chicago Midway International Airport (KMDW/MDW) is a busy civil airfield in the United States, situated at an elevation of 189 meters. It features ten asphalt and concrete runways, with the longest primary runway stretching nearly 2,000 meters, supporting VFR traffic. The airport offers multiple communication frequencies including tower, ground, and approach/departure, making it an important hub for aviation enthusiasts and student pilots in Chicago.
